Common Concrete Pavement Repair Jobs
Crack Repair - addressing surface cracks to prevent further deterioration and maintain pavement integrity.
Pothole Filling - restoring smoothness and safety by filling and leveling potholes in concrete surfaces.
Joint Repair - sealing and repairing expansion and control joints to reduce cracking and water intrusion.
Surface Resurfacing - applying a new layer over existing pavement to improve appearance and extend lifespan.
Spall Repair - fixing surface spalls caused by freeze-thaw cycles or heavy loads for a safer surface.
Full-Depth Patching - removing and replacing severely damaged sections for long-lasting repair.
Concrete Pavement Repair Questions
What types of damage can be repaired on concrete pavements? Cracks, surface spalling, and minor unevenness are common issues that can be addressed through repair services.
How does concrete pavement repair improve property value? Repairing damaged pavement enhances curb appeal and helps maintain the structural integrity of the property.
Are repairs suitable for all types of concrete pavements? Repairs are effective on most concrete surfaces, including driveways, walkways, and parking areas, depending on the extent of damage.
What signs indicate the need for concrete pavement repair? Visible cracking, uneven surfaces, and surface deterioration are key indicators that repair may be necessary.
